A small number of industrial sectors are not eligible for support including banks, building societies, insurers and reinsurers (though not insurance brokers), the public sector and membership organisations or trade unions; and have a sound borrowing proposal which, were it not for the current pandemic, would be considered viable by the lender, and for which the lender believes the provision of finance will enable the business to trade out of any short-to-medium term difficulty. Section 4008 – Debt Guaranty Authority Section 4008 of the CARES Act authorizes the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) to establish a debt guarantee program to guarantee the debt of solvent insured depository institutions and depository institution holding companies. [read post]
